Community Input Requested Regarding the Seattle Tilth Teaching Gardens

The Seattle Tilth Teaching Gardens have been at the Good Shepherd Center and Meridian Playground for more than thirty years. The gardens are located on Seattle Parks property under a lease agreement that allows Seattle Tilth to maintain the gardens as a regional educational resource. Seattle Tilth is in the process of renegotiating our lease with the City of Seattle Parks and Recreation Department to continue garden and educational programs.

As part of that process, Seattle Tilth must gather community input, reviewing our use of the property with neighbors, friends, and interested community members.
